Output 76232bc76d30e29cae5a37944c244ec7afd294d94dac47285c15475fc02fdaaa:145

value
34075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ead62bbe81b55d1d60f967e5a9837d7f4b5d0a OP_EQUAL
address
3Je4FmNE8N5jLaEayWKTJEiCLgBqaWxmva
transaction
76232bc76d30e29cae5a37944c244ec7afd294d94dac47285c15475fc02fdaaa